Stability of Wheelchair and Seating Systems
• To ensurethatthe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emandwheelchairaresafetouse,itis
importantthatttingthe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emtothewheelchairdoesnotmake
thewheelchairunstableduringnormal
dailyuse.EachDigi-SeatSeatingSystem
whenhandedovertotheuserwillbe
testedforstabilitytotherelevantangleof
stabilityforthechairtobetested.
The• recommendedmaximumangleof
tiltis12degreesforattendanttransit
wheelchairsand16degreesforusers
ofselfpropellingwheelchairsand16
degreesforusersofelectricindoorand
outdoorelectricwheelchairs.
If• theclientisgoingtouseadditionalitems
mountedtothewheelchairorseating
systemsuchascommunicationsaidsetc.,
thenitisessentialthatthetestbedone
withtheseinsitutoaccesstheirimpact
onthesafetyofthewheelchair.Similarly,
simpleitemssuchastraysneedtobeinplaceforthetesttotakeintoaccountallthe
equipmenttobeusedbytheclient(seediagramopposite).
The• stabilitytestisalwaysdonewiththeclientseatedintheseatingsystemandall
equipmenttobeusedbytheclientonadailybasiswheninthewheelchairinsitu.The
combinedclientSeatingSystemandwheelchairassemblyistestedtothespecied
maximumangleoftilt.
Once• thetesthasbeensuccessfullycompletedaStabilityCerticatewillbeissued
bySpecialisedOrthoticServicesLimited.Acopyofthiscerticatewillbehandedover
whentheequipmentissuppliedandshouldbekeptwiththeusermanualforfuture
reference.

General Safety Guidelines for
Wheelchair User Transportation
Wheelchairusersshouldtransfertovehicleseatswheneverpossible.•
Wheelchair• usersshouldnottravelwiththewheelchairatanangleorfacingsideways
tothedirectionoftravel.
There• shouldbesufcientfreespacearoundthewheelchairandusertoavoidthe
usermakingcontactwithothervehicleoccupants,unpaddedpartsofthevehicle,
wheelchairaccessoriesorW.T.O.R.S.anchorpoints.
Wheelchairs• shouldhavetheparkingbrakesappliedandtheirpowerunitsswitchedoff
duringvehiclemovement.Poweredwheelchairsshouldnotbeleftinfreewheelmode.
Wheelchairs• shouldnotblockgangwaysandexitsforotherpassengersinthevehicle.
A• headrestshouldbeprovidedforawheelchairuserwhentravellinginavehiclewhere
otherseatedpassengershaveheadrests.
Do• notplace/hanganyadditionalitemsontothewheelchairduringtransportation
suchasshoppingbagsandholdalls.
Trays• shouldberemovedfortransportationwheneverpossible.Ifitisnecessaryfora
traytobeusedontransportation,thenariskassessmentshouldbedone.
Wheelchair Tie Down and Occupant Restraint System
(W.T.O.R.S.)
Securemethodsforthesaferetentionofwheelchairshavebeendevelopedandare•
usedonaregularbasistosecurewheelchairsduringtransportationuse.
These• systemsarenowcommonlyreferredtoasW.T.O.R.S.
Wheelchair Tie down and Occupant Restraint Systems
TherearemanytypesofW.T.O.R.S.availablefromvariousmanufacturers(alistof•
somemanufacturersisgivenonpage9).RefertoyourWheelchairManufacturers
Handbookfordetailsoftheirparticularrecommendations.
Please• notethatalllap/chestbeltsandharnessessuppliedwiththeseatingsystem
are notsufcientforoccupantrestraintwhentheequipmentisusedonamoving
vehicleandadditionalOccupantRestraintisrequired.

2. OCCUPANT RESTRAINT SYSTEM
Wheelchair• users should not travel in cars, taxis or minibuses, unless an
occupant restraint system is in place on the client.
For
• anyclienttobetransportedsafelyintheSeatingSystemandwheelchair,itis
essentialthatanOccupantRestraintSystembeused.
SOS• haveprovenduringcrashtestsonDigi-SeatSeatingSystemsthattransporting
anyclientonamovingvehiclewithoutanapprovedoccupantrestraintsystemis
extremelydangerousandwillplacetheclient at great risk.
It
• isimportantthattheOccupantRestraintSystemispositionedcorrectlyasmost
clientsusingSpecialSeatingwillbedependentoncarersforcorrectplacementofthe
occupantrestraint.
Consideration• shouldbegiventothemostsuitabletypeandpositioningofrestraintfor
theuser,bothinnormaltravelandduringanimpact.
The• OccupantRestraintshouldhaveaclearpathfromtheusertotheanchorpoint
andshouldnotbeinterferedwithbyanypartofthevehicle,wheelchair,seatingor
accessory.

Stowage of the Seating System and Wheelchair
DuringuseofyourSpecialSeatingSystemitmaybenecessaryforyoutoremovethe•
SeatingSystemandstowthisalongwiththewheelchairinavehicle.
It• isimportanttorealisethattheseitemsposeariskifnotadequatelyrestrained
whilstintransit.
It• isnotadequatetosimplyplacetheitemsintoacarbootortheoorofanopen
vehiclesuchasanMPVorestatecarasinacollisiontheseunsecureditemscould
causeserious injurytooccupantsofthevehicle.
Various• retentionmethodsareavailabletosecuresuchequipmentduringtransit,and
onceagainthelistofWheelchairRestraintSystemManufacturersinthisbookletwill
behappytoadviseonthismatter(seebelow).

USER GUIDE 2.0
2.1. LIFTING & HANDLING THE CLIENT IN & OUT OF THE DIGI-SEAT SYSTEM
Most• usersofDigi-SeatSeatingSystemswillneedtobehoistedintotheequipment.
Manuallyliftingtheclientisnotrecommended,howeverwithsomeclientsitmaynot
bepossibletohoistthemsafelybyconventionalmeansandininstancessuchas
thisyouarerecommendedtocarryouta‘RISK ASSESSMENT’toassesstherisks
involvedinanysuchaction.
It• isimportantthatallcarersareawareoftheHealth&Safetyguidelinesfor‘Lifting
and Handling’.
Before• liftingtheclientmakesureallstrapsareplacedoutoftheDigi-SeatSeating
System.Thiswillavoidthestrapsbecomingtrappedundertheclientwhenseated.
When• usingthehoist,makesurethatyoufollowthehoist manufacturers
instructionsregardingcorrectuse.
On• loweringtheclientintothe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emmakesurethattheclient’s
hips/pelvisarelocatedasfarbackaspossibleintotheseat.
Leaving• thehoistslinginthe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emoncetheclienthasbeen
placedisnotrecommendedasthiscouldcausediscomfortandpressureareasto
begenerated.However,ifanymanagementissuesrequiretheslingtobeleftinsitu
thenitisrecommendedthatthemostappropriateslingbeused.Ifyourequirefurther
informationregardingthis,contactyourlocalWheelchairServiceTherapist.
Please• note, that it is very important that the client is correctly positioned to
give maximum comfort and support.

USER GUIDE 3.0
MAINTENANCE OF THE DIGI-SEAT SYSTEM
To makesurethatthe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emremainssatisfactoryitisnecessaryto
carryoutsimplemaintenance.
3.1. CLEANING THE DIGI-SEAT SYSTEM
All• thecoversontheDigi-Seatseatingsystemcanberemovedforwashing.(Please
refer to the instruction label on the inside of the cover for washing instructions.)
The
• Carved Foam Supportsaresealedinaspecialwaterproofclearplastic
protectiveskinwhichalthoughwaterproofisairpermeabletoassistdaily
management.Under no circumstances is the clear protective skin to be removed
as the foam will have no protection against contamination and will need to
be replaced. If the plastic skin becomes seriously damaged contact SOS
immediately.
With
• thecoversremoved,tocleanthemouldedsupports,simplywipedownwith
milddetergentandadampclothandtoweldryandleaveatroomtemperaturetodry
thoroughly.Undernocircumstancesuseexcessiveheattotrytodrythefoamasthis
coulddamagetheprotectiveskin.
DO• NOT PUT THE DIGI-SEAT SYSTEM NEXT TO A HOT FIRE OR USE
EXCESSIVE HEAT TO DRY AS EXCESSIVE HEAT COULD AFFECT THE
COMPONENTS OF THE SEAT.
DO
• NOT USE SCOURERS OR CAUSTIC SUBSTANCES SUCH AS BLEACH.
3.2. REMOVABLE COVERS
For• cleaningofremovablecoverspleaserefertowashlabelontheinsideofthe
paddedcover.
To• removethecoverssimplyremovethesupportsfromtheDigi-SeatSeatingSystem
andunzipthecoveroneachsupport.
DO• NOT REMOVE THE FOAM FROM THE WATERPROOF LINER OR TRY TO
WASH IT AS THIS FOAM WILL ABSORB WATER AND WILL BE A PROBLEM TO
DRY OUT.
ANY
• DEVIATIONS FROM THE ABOVE MAY AFFECT THE FIRE RETARDANCY OF
THE COVER(S).
3.3. HARNESSES, PADS & STRAPS
Make• sureallstrapsareingoodworkingorderandthatbucklesworkcorrectly.
If• anyshowsignsoffrayingoranybucklesarebrokenorfaultycontactyour
WheelchairServiceimmediately,DO NOT ATTEMPT TO REPAIR.
Harnesses
• maybecleanedbyapplyingawarmdampclothwithamilddetergent,
DO NOT USE POLISH.

17
3.4. VISUAL INSPECTION
Every• 3-4weekschecktheconditionofthe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emand
wheelchair,ifyounoticeanyfaultsorbrokenpartspleasenotifyyourWheelchair
Serviceimmediately,DO NOT ATTEMPT TO REPAIR.
Look
• atthetubularframesoftheDigi-SeatSeatingSystemandmakesurethereare
nosignsofdistortion,makesuretheyaresecurelyattachedtotheshelloftheseat
andtherearenolooseattachments.
Make• surethatallxingsaresecure,especiallyaftermakinganyadjustments.
Check• theshelloftheseatforanysignsofseverewearandtear.Alsothefoamlining
oftheseat.
3.5. FIRE RETARDANCY
Fire• retardantmaterialshavebeenusedintheconstructionofthisseatingsystem.
It• isimportantthatnoaccelerantsareintroducedtothematerials(e.g.Hairspray,fabric
cleaners,deodorants,polishetc..),asthismayadverselyaffectthereretardancyof
yourequipment.
